8. Olive Branch Tattoo
The olive branch is a timeless symbol of peace, wisdom, and unity. In tattoo form, it’s a simple yet powerful design, often chosen for its deep meaning. Olive branches have historically been used to symbolize peace treaties and hope, and the tattoo can serve as a reminder to live a balanced life, free from conflict. The slender, elegant lines of an olive branch make for a delicate tattoo that can be placed on the wrist, behind the ear, or along the forearm. For those seeking a tattoo with a meaningful message, the olive branch is an ideal choice. This design also works well for those who want a subtle and graceful tattoo that represents inner peace, harmony, and love.

10. Pineapple Heart Tattoo
The pineapple, a symbol of hospitality, warmth, and friendship, paired with a heart design, creates a tattoo full of positive meaning. A pineapple heart tattoo combines the sweetness and vibrant energy of the fruit with the universal symbol of love, making it an ideal design for those who want to express joy, affection, and connection. This tattoo can represent your love for tropical places, as pineapples are often associated with warm, sunny climates. Whether placed on your forearm, ankle, or wrist, a pineapple heart tattoo is both cute and meaningful, serving as a reminder to spread love and positivity wherever you go. The bright colors of the pineapple and heart make this design stand out, making it an eye-catching, joyful piece of body art.
